Editor Review

Rated a 3.5

First, the pros: Blistex Lip Infusion Moisture Splash gives lips a slick, wet look, is inexpensive and is available at almost any drugstore. The cons: One application lasts about 20 minutes if you're lucky, and once it dries up, lips feel more parched than before application. Plus, the liquid formula doesn't taste good -- a bummer since it easily slides off lips and into your mouth. And though the formula contains SPF, the protection is questionable since the formula dries so quickly. A much better buy: Blistex Silk & Shine.

  • Ingredients

  • Active Ingredients: Lanolin (13.0% w/w) (skin protectant), Octinoxate (7.5% w/w) (sunscreen), Oxybenzone (2% w/w) (sunscreen) Inactive Ingredients: Aloe Barbadensis Leaf Extract, BIS Diglyceryl Polyacyladipate 2, Flavor, Fragrance, Pentaerythrityl Tetraisostearate, Phenoxyethanol, Saccharin, Simmondsia Chinensis Seed Oil (jojoba), Squalane
